Lines Matching refs:group

81     // SipProfile URI --> group
129 for (SipSessionGroupExt group : mSipGroups.values()) {
130 if (isCallerRadio || isCallerCreator(group)) {
131 profiles.add(group.getLocalProfile());
165 SipSessionGroupExt group = createGroup(localProfile,
168 group.openToReceiveCalls();
177 private boolean isCallerCreator(SipSessionGroupExt group) {
178 SipProfile profile = group.getLocalProfile();
182 private boolean isCallerCreatorOrRadio(SipSessionGroupExt group) {
183 return (isCallerRadio() || isCallerCreator(group));
194 SipSessionGroupExt group = mSipGroups.get(localProfileUri);
195 if (group == null) return;
196 if (!isCallerCreatorOrRadio(group)) {
201 group = mSipGroups.remove(localProfileUri);
202 notifyProfileRemoved(group.getLocalProfile());
203 group.close();
212 SipSessionGroupExt group = mSipGroups.get(localProfileUri);
213 if (group == null) return false;
214 if (isCallerCreatorOrRadio(group)) {
226 SipSessionGroupExt group = mSipGroups.get(localProfileUri);
227 if (group == null) return false;
228 if (isCallerCreatorOrRadio(group)) {
229 return group.isRegistered();
241 SipSessionGroupExt group = mSipGroups.get(localProfileUri);
242 if (group == null) return;
243 if (isCallerCreator(group)) {
244 group.setListener(listener);
262 SipSessionGroupExt group = createGroup(localProfile);
263 return group.createSession(listener);
293 SipSessionGroupExt group = mSipGroups.get(key);
294 if (group == null) {
295 group = new SipSessionGroupExt(localProfile, null, null);
296 mSipGroups.put(key, group);
298 } else if (!isCallerCreator(group)) {
301 return group;
308 SipSessionGroupExt group = mSipGroups.get(key);
309 if (group != null) {
310 if (!isCallerCreator(group)) {
313 group.setIncomingCallPendingIntent(incomingCallPendingIntent);
314 group.setListener(listener);
316 group = new SipSessionGroupExt(localProfile,
318 mSipGroups.put(key, group);
321 return group;
411 for (SipSessionGroupExt group : mSipGroups.values()) {
412 if ((group != ringingGroup) && group.containsSession(callId)) {
415 + " -> " + group.getLocalProfile().getUriString());
423 for (SipSessionGroupExt group : mSipGroups.values()) {
424 group.onKeepAliveIntervalChanged();
791 public void start(SipSessionGroup group) {
796 group.createSession(this);
806 if (SAR_DBG) log("start: group=" + group);
1141 for (SipSessionGroupExt group : mSipGroups.values()) {
1142 if (group.isOpenedToReceiveCalls()) {
1192 for (SipSessionGroupExt group : mSipGroups.values()) {
1193 group.onConnectivityChanged(false);
1202 for (SipSessionGroupExt group : mSipGroups.values()) {
1203 group.onConnectivityChanged(true);